Just learn it online.
Not a fan of any gold/silver seminar by investment scheme/group, because i think they just want to sell their products.

The point is, u buy some recognized gold and pawn it. If u get lucky and the gold prizes increased, u gain. That`s all.
U must have a thick blood because there`s plenty of factors to considered.

If u committed for gold investment, just buy 995 or 999.
916 are more towards jewellery not investment nod.gif

QUOTE(FrancescoTop8 @ Sep 4 2011, 10:25 PM)
916 are more towards jewellery not investment  nod.gif
*
Except 916 has robustness for general circulation coinage, as opposed to 995 or 999 [Which is why most Islamic dinars are minted to 916/917 standards]. Though in such a situation, that means fiat money has literally gone up in flames!
